Summary: Efficient light 2009-08-14
Comment: This light is great, except for the design. If you intend on using the pull chain to turn the light on and off, the way it's designed, it will wear the paint off the light fixture in short order, unless you're willing to lift the chain way up and pull it straight out. Other than that design flaw, the light works great, throws good light evenly. They should require the engineers who design these things to use them in real life before they sell them.

Summary: Bright, Energy Efficient 2008-08-17
Comment: Despite the sketchy instructions, the light kit was easy to install on a Hunter fan that I purchased locally. My guess is that people with little experience with wiring and light fixture installation may need some help from someone who is handy. When I installed the fan I did end up calling Hunter's help line with a wiring question. I was on hold for a long time, but when I did get through, the agent was helpful and knowledgeable. Don't forget that there is a pull-chain switch on the fan itself. I turned on the light at the wall switch, and for a few minutes could not figure out why it didn't work.
